The Rising Heat: A Look at Increasing Heatwave Frequency and Intensity
The article highlights Spain’s impending heatwave, but this isn’t an isolated event. Across Europe and globally, we’re seeing a significant rise in both the frequency and intensity of heatwaves. Data from the European Environment Agency (EEA) shows a clear trend: heatwaves are becoming more frequent, longer-lasting, and more severe. These are not just blips on the radar; they’re the new normal.
One of the key drivers behind this trend is, of course, climate change. The increasing concentration of greenhouse gases in the atmosphere is trapping heat, leading to higher average temperatures and an increased likelihood of extreme weather events. Adapting to a Hotter World: Innovations and Strategies
As the planet warms, adaptation becomes crucial. It’s no longer enough to simply mitigate climate change; we must also learn to live with its impacts. Spain, and other regions facing similar challenges, are at the forefront of developing innovative adaptation strategies.
Cooling Cities: Urban planning is crucial. Initiatives such as increasing green spaces (parks, green roofs), using lighter-colored building materials to reflect sunlight, and improving ventilation in buildings can help mitigate the “urban heat island” effect, where cities are significantly hotter than surrounding rural areas.
Early Warning Systems: Robust early warning systems are vital to protect vulnerable populations, such as the elderly and those with health conditions. These systems provide timely alerts, enabling people to take precautions like staying indoors and drinking plenty of water.
Water Management: Water scarcity is a major concern in many regions experiencing extreme heat. Innovative water management techniques, including rainwater harvesting, water-efficient irrigation systems, and the exploration of desalination technologies, are becoming increasingly important.

The Role of Policy and Public Awareness
Government policies play a significant role in shaping how societies respond to the threat of extreme heat. This includes implementing stricter building codes to improve energy efficiency, investing in public health campaigns to raise awareness, and providing financial support for adaptation measures.
Public awareness is equally important. Educating people about the risks of heatwaves, promoting heat-health action plans, and fostering a culture of preparedness can save lives. Community engagement, collaborative efforts, and knowledge-sharing between different local municipalities can also improve the resilience in communities.

Frequently Asked Questions (FAQ)
Q: What is a “tropical night”?
A: A “tropical night” is a night where the temperature does not drop below 20 degrees Celsius.
Q: What are the main risks of heatwaves?
A: Heatwaves can lead to heatstroke, dehydration, and cardiovascular issues, particularly for vulnerable groups.
Q: How can I prepare for a heatwave?
A: Stay hydrated, stay indoors during the hottest part of the day, and check on vulnerable neighbors.
Q: What is the urban heat island effect?
A: The urban heat island effect occurs when cities experience higher temperatures than surrounding rural areas due to factors like dark surfaces, lack of vegetation, and waste heat from buildings.
